Agistment Options

Glenworth Valley offers several types of agistment to suit all needs and budgets. Which option you choose depends on factors such as your budget, type of horse, type and amount of riding you do. Whatever your preference, there is a home here for your horse. All horses have access to our improved pastures, safe fencing, supervision, regular worming and dentist appointments.

Spelling agistment

Spelling agistment is for either retired horses, horses requiring convalescence or those needing a break. Our spelling horses enjoy natural and peaceful surroundings. Due to the nature of this type of agistment, facilities are limited at the spelling properties.

Paddock rates are $47.00 per week.

Riding agistment

Let your horse enjoy the best that nature has to offer. The riding agistment is by far our most popular agistment and represents great value for money. Whilst you have access to all the facilities and riding trails, your horse has access to the most natural environment you can provide. The paddocks are rotated on a weekly basis and the horses are brought closer to the carpark and facilities area over the weekend. However the horses are still easily accessible during the week and you are welcome to visit your horse as you please.

The number of horses in riding agistment can vary however all of our paddocks are large enough to accommodate the number of horses in each thus ensuring they are never overstocked. These horses have access to many different paddocks ensuring there is no competition for feed.

Paddock rates are $53.00 - $65.00 per week, depending on which property your horse is located at.

Small group agistment

Small group agistment enjoys all the same benefits as the riding agistment but on a smaller scale. There are approximately 4-12 horses in a paddock.

Paddock rates are from $70.00 - $85.00 per week.

Feed program paddock

If you would like your horse fed they usually have to be in either a separate paddock or one of the special "feed program" paddocks. A full range of supplementary feeding and rugging/unrugging programs are available. Only the best quality feeds are used and these are fed according to the manufacturers recommendations. Products used provide a complete and economical "cool" energy feed. 

These paddocks have specially designed individual yards to ensure your horse enjoys all of their feed without any stress or competition.

The feed program paddock rates are $70.00 per week (paddock costs only). Feed program options start at $30.00 per week (excluding feed costs). If you would like your horse fed they usually have to be in either a separate paddock or one of the special "feed program" paddocks.

 

On arrival at Glenworth Valley you are required to complete an application for agistment form and to pay for one month's agistment and an initial drench upfront. Thereafter, agistment fees are paid one month in advance. Statements of account are forwarded on the 15th of each month. Agistment fees are debited to your account on the last Saturday of the month. Weekly service fees will be charged on overdue accounts.

All horses are drenched on arrival, and then every second month. Drench costs are $33 per drench, and this cost is debited to your agistment account in advance.

Payment may be made in person at the Glenworth Valley office, online through our website, by post or by B-Pay. We also have eftpos and credit card facilities in the yard office. Cheques and Money Orders should be made payable to Glenworth Valley Horse Riding Pty Ltd.
